Statue of Australian Poet Vandalized

Originally Published: January 16, 2012

According to this article on Adelaidenow, a statue of C.J. Dennis, "one of Australia's greatest poets" has been vandalized.

Police said more than $10,000 damage was caused to the frame of the steel and copper structure at Laura on December 29. The statue is of Dennis holding a pipe and reading a book of his verse.

Northern Areas Council has removed the $25,000 statue for repairs.

Known for his bestseller The Sentimental Bloke, Dennis, who was born in Auburn in 1876, outsold both Banjo Paterson and Henry Lawson during his lifetime.

Darren Pech, member of the Laura Community Development and Tourism Association, said the statue had been in Laura's main street for less than 12 months, after it was gifted to the community by former resident Dick Biles on his death. "The community is very disappointed that something that was donated to the town has been vandalised," he said.
